WebSep 30, 2005 · Cystic appendix epididymis on US examinations was classified according to the presence of the stalk and size of the cyst. Testicular appendages have been identified in 337 out of 544 testes (61.9%). Of them, 241 were appendix testis (44.3%) and 96 (17.6%) were appendix epididymis. WebDec 1, 2011 · Cyst of the appendix testis and appendix epididymis The appendices of the testis and epididymis are residual cells from the ducts of Muller or mesonephric duct tissue. They are commonly found at autopsy [21], although US examination reveals their presence in only 6%–17% of patients [22].
